IoT System Design: Software and Hardware Integration

About this Course

This course is designed to teach you how systems are developed using IoT technology. Many engineers and developers tend to focus ona single discipline - either software or hardware. However, in today’s connectedage it's critical to have a comprehensive understanding of both disciplines and how they are intertwined. In this practical course, you'll gain a holistic understanding of system development from both software and hardware perspectives. A truly hands-on experience, you will develop your own embedded system. In doing so, you'll learn as much from your failures as your successes as you go along. Note: In this course, we will use DE10-Nano Development Kit by Terasic Inc.

Created by: Waseda University

Level: Intermediate
